| 1:08.7 | Twitter says it's freeing up handles by deleting inactive accounts. Facebook buys the VR studio behind the popular |
| 1:15.0 | Beat Saber, and an Indian scooter startup raises $150 million. |
| 1:21.0 | Here's your daily crunch for November 27th, 2019. |
| 1:25.0 | First up, Twitter is going to free up handles by deleting inactive accounts, said the company, |
| 1:31.0 | as part of our commitment to serve the public conversation, we're working to clean up |
| 1:34.7 | inactive accounts to present more accurate, credible information people can trust across |
| 1:39.1 | Twitter. |
| 1:40.6 | Sounds like a smart move, with one big catch. |
